public class JaxbConfigurationImpl extends ResourceConfigurationImpl implements org.kie.internal.builder.JaxbConfiguration
RESOURCE_TYPE| Constructor and Description |
|---|
JaxbConfigurationImpl() |
JaxbConfigurationImpl(com.sun.tools.xjc.Options xjcOpts,
String systemId) |
| Modifier and Type | Method and Description |
|---|---|
org.kie.internal.builder.JaxbConfiguration |
fromByteArray(byte[] conf) |
org.kie.api.io.ResourceConfiguration |
fromProperties(Properties prop) |
List<String> |
getClasses() |
String |
getSystemId() |
com.sun.tools.xjc.Options |
getXjcOpts() |
void |
setClasses(List<String> classes) |
void |
setSystemId(String systemId) |
void |
setXjcOpts(com.sun.tools.xjc.Options xjcOpts) |
byte[] |
toByteArray() |
Properties |
toProperties() |
getResourceType, merge, setResourceTypepublic JaxbConfigurationImpl()
public JaxbConfigurationImpl(com.sun.tools.xjc.Options xjcOpts,
String systemId)
public com.sun.tools.xjc.Options getXjcOpts()
getXjcOpts in interface org.kie.internal.builder.JaxbConfigurationpublic String getSystemId()
getSystemId in interface org.kie.internal.builder.JaxbConfigurationpublic List<String> getClasses()
getClasses in interface org.kie.internal.builder.JaxbConfigurationpublic void setSystemId(String systemId)
public void setXjcOpts(com.sun.tools.xjc.Options xjcOpts)
public byte[] toByteArray()
public org.kie.internal.builder.JaxbConfiguration fromByteArray(byte[] conf)
public Properties toProperties()
toProperties in interface org.kie.api.io.ResourceConfigurationtoProperties in class ResourceConfigurationImplpublic org.kie.api.io.ResourceConfiguration fromProperties(Properties prop)
fromProperties in interface org.kie.api.io.ResourceConfigurationfromProperties in class ResourceConfigurationImplCopyright © 2001–2018 JBoss by Red Hat. All rights reserved.